Experience dog sledding
At Expedition Wolf, ride through the snowy hills and meet the sled dogs!
Go skiing or snowboarding
First, take a lesson (if you’re a beginner like me!). Then go out there and enjoy the ride!
Enjoy the après-ski
After being outside all day, wind down at the microbrasserie La Diable.
Try fat-biking
With tons of trails around Mont Tremblant, it’s a fun new winter sport to try out.
Relax at the spa
From hot tubs to cold river water, relaxing at the spa is a must.
Take a gondola ride to the summit
Even if you don’t ski, enjoy panoramic views of the mountain the whole way up.
Experience a helicopter ride
For insane views of the Laurentian Mountains, go high!
Stay at the Fairmont hotel
A true ski in ski out experience anyone would fall in love with.
Take a stroll in the village
Walk around the European inspired pedestrian village, full of color and French Canadian joie-de-vivre.
Go sliding
Enjoy your evening with an activity that’s thrilling to do over and over again.
